Hera Sauna เฮรา ซาวน่า
Hera Sauna is a wellness facility located on Thep Prasit Road in central Pattaya, offering sauna sessions, steam treatments, and spa services in a setting designed for genuine relaxation. Its position in the Muang Pattaya area makes it a practical stop for travellers looking to decompress between beach days or sightseeing, without venturing far from the city's main attractions. The atmosphere is suited to both solo visitors and small groups, with a focus on providing a calm, restorative environment away from Pattaya's busier streetside activity. The facility draws consistent positive feedback from guests, reflecting a reliable standard of service and a genuine commitment to the wellness experience rather than a transactional approach common in high-turnover tourist areas. Good to know: Hera Sauna operates seven days a week from 9:00 AM to 10:00 PM, giving visitors significant flexibility regardless of their schedule. Weekday afternoons tend to offer a quieter experience for those who prefer a more relaxed atmosphere. Checking the official website at hera-sauna.com before visiting is recommended, as it provides details on available treatments, pricing, and any current packages or promotions that may not be listed elsewhere.

Vet Elephant Sanctuaries
Only visit sanctuaries that prohibit riding, use no chains or bullhooks, and let elephants roam freely. Elephant Nature Park in Chiang Mai set the standard. If a place offers painting shows or circus tricks, walk away.
Book Through Klook or GetYourGuide
These platforms offer instant confirmation, free cancellation on most activities, and prices that are often lower than walk-up rates. Compare with local agencies for multi-day trips where negotiation might save more.
Do Outdoor Activities in the Morning
Heat and humidity peak from noon to 3 PM. Schedule jungle treks, cycling tours, and outdoor cooking classes for early morning. Water activities are more flexible since you're in and out of the sea.

Visitor Information
Best time to visit
November – February
Avoid: June – October (rainy, rough seas)
Rainy season
May – October
Avg. temperature
24°C – 33°C(75°F – 91°F)
Crowds
Peak: December – January
Getting there
Minibus from Suvarnabhumi Airport (~1.5 hrs). Bus from Bangkok's Eastern Bus Terminal Ekkamai (~2 hrs). No direct train.
Getting around
- •Baht buses (songthaews on fixed routes)
- •Grab (widely available)
- •Motorbike taxis
- •Ferry to Koh Larn island
